OFFICIAL NHTSA RECALL
12V375000
Equipment
Reported Aug 2, 2012 · VERMEER MANUFACTURING COMPANY
Summary
Vermeer is recalling certain model year 2009-2012 single axle brush chipper trailers because the axle mounting bolts could loosen, leading to axle separation from the brush chipper.
Consequence
If the axle separates from the brush chipper, there is an increased risk of a crash.
Remedy
Vermeer will notify owners, and dealers will replace the mounting bolts, free of charge. The recall began ion August 21, 2012. Owners may contact Vermeer at 641-628-3141.
